Princeton's WordNet4.0 / 1 vote

  1. monotony, humdrum, samenessadjective

    the quality of wearisome constancy, routine, and lack of variety

    "he had never grown accustomed to the monotony of his work"; "he was sick of the humdrum of his fellow prisoners"; "he hated the sameness of the food the college served"

    Synonyms:
    sameness, monotony

    Antonyms:
    exciting, lively

  2. commonplace, humdrum, prosaic, unglamorous, unglamourousadjective

    not challenging; dull and lacking excitement

    "an unglamorous job greasing engines"

    Synonyms:
    shopworn, prosaic, monotonous, trite, old-hat, unglamorous, earthbound, threadbare, tired, timeworn, stock(a), matter-of-fact, hackneyed, well-worn, banal, prosy, commonplace, pedestrian, unglamourous

    Antonyms:
    lively, exciting

  3. humdrum, monotonousadjective

    tediously repetitious or lacking in variety

    "a humdrum existence; all work and no play"; "nothing is so monotonous as the sea"

    Synonyms:
    monotonic, unglamourous, monotone, commonplace, monotonous, unglamorous, prosaic, flat

    Antonyms:
    lively, exciting

How to use humdrum in a sentence?

  1. Saki:

    Scandal is merely the compassionate allowance which the gay make to the humdrum. Think how many blameless lives are brightened by the blazing indiscretions of other people.

  2. Carl Sagan:

    Who are we? We find that we live on an insignificant planet of a humdrum star lost in a galaxy tucked away in some forgotten corner of a universe in which there are far more galaxies than people.

  3. Joseph de Maistre:

    In the works of man, everything is as poor as its author; vision is confined, means are limited, scope is restricted, movements are labored, and results are humdrum.

  4. John Prine:

    I didn't expect to do this for a living, being a recording artist, i was just playing music for the fun of it and writing songs. That was kind of my escape, you know, from the humdrum of the world.
